WebWhen it comes to hardening and softening C260, or cartridge brass, there are only 3 factors that affect hardness. The factors are; #1 The amount of work done to the brass. #2 The amount of heat (temperature) applied to the brass. #3 The duration of time the brass remains at the elevated temperature. WebMay 21, 2024 · Real color case hardening was done after a firearm was engraved to harden the surface of the steel, the colors were a happy byproduct of the initial process. Trial and error led it to being an art form in getting certain colors. Ruger and probably Uberti use a chemical finish to simulate color case hardening.
